Kent Farrington and Caitlin Boyle win at The National

LEXINGTON, Ky.--Kent Farrington on Grass De Mars won the $31,020 CSI3* 1.45M International Speed class, and Caitlin Boyle won the $31,020 Winning Round class on Friday evening, Nov. 1 at The National Horse Show.

Kent Farrington on Grass De MarsFarrington, going 19th of 21 starters, finished clean in 62.47 to just edge out Simon McCarthy of Ireland on Gotcha, who went just before Farrington and finished clean in 62.71over the course set by Alan Wade.

 Farrington and McCarthy were far clear of the rest of the field, with Jessie Springsteen on Naomi van het Kiezershof third in 66.30, followed by Alise Oken on Oraline Van Prinseveld, clean in 66.75, Jimmy Torano on Kochio Z, clean in 68.448 and completing the top six was Beat Mandli of Switzerland on Quintane VD Roshoeve, clean n 72,2.

“Grass De Mars is an 8-year-old horse that I own with Katie Jacobs, and I’m super excited about my partnership with her, said Farrington. "It’s great to have our first international win at the National Horse Show. I’ve been partnered with this horse since Florida and we’ve done a couple 2* Grand Prix, and she came in second at a National Grand Prix so she is coming along nicely.”

 

BOYLE ON Navaar was clean in 33.73 to win the Winning Round over Brianne Gout-=Marteau on Biance, clean in 34.01, and Alex Matz on Ikigai, clean in 34.79.

In the Winning Round, the top 10 finishers in the first round moved on to the jump-off, so Jimmy Torano on Chewbacca, who had been clean in the first round, was the slowest of the 11 clean so didn't make the jump-off.

Katie Dinan on Amiro B Z was fourth in 35.24,with Charlie Jacobs on Camila 111fifth in 37.20 and Dinan on Out Of The Blue SCF sixth in 39.43.

Campbell Brown on Caiam D’ivraie won the $10,000 Junior/Amateur Jumper,clean in 60.43.

“The plan was to start with a fast canter and then keep it all the way around," said Brown. "I was hoping to do the six in the line which I was able to do nicely. He’s been my partner for a long time so I trust him to do the leave outs. I went in and stuck to my plan which ended up working out because I had a great round that led me to my first win here at the National Horse Show. I have been coming here for a couple years now so it was pretty special to get to come and win on a horse that I love so much.”
